Critical Incident Stress

A critical incident — a call or event so disturbing it overwhelms your ability to cope — can leave physical, emotional, and spiritual aftershocks that last for months. This is not weakness; it is a normal human response to an abnormal event, and it can happen to the most seasoned professional. The sooner you understand what is happening and reach for support, the sooner the weight begins to lift. You don't have to carry a critical incident alone.
